Coinbase Diversifies Beyond Trading, Poised for Growth
Market Context
Wall Street analysts remain bullish on Coinbase following the cryptocurrency exchange’s strong Q3 performance. The analysts point to Coinbase’s diversification beyond its core trading business as a key driver of future growth, with derivatives, stablecoins, and the company’s Base network emerging as the next growth engines.
Strategic Implications
Coinbase’s move to expand its product suite beyond spot trading is a strategic shift that aims to reduce reliance on the volatility of the crypto markets. Derivatives, which allow traders to speculate on the future price of assets, and stablecoins, which provide price stability, offer more consistent revenue streams. Additionally, the Base network, Coinbase’s layer-2 scaling solution, positions the company to capitalize on the growing demand for decentralized applications and infrastructure.
PE Angle
For private equity and institutional investors, Coinbase’s diversification efforts signal a maturing cryptocurrency ecosystem with opportunities for steady, long-term growth. The company’s focus on diversifying its revenue streams and expanding its product offerings aligns with the investment community’s preference for businesses with more predictable cash flows and resilience to market fluctuations.
